Warning Signs You Need Storm Damage Restoration
Ignoring storm dam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can indicate mold growth or water damage. Don’t ignore these smells – they can be a sign of a bigger problem.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le. This can lead to further damage and even create a tripping hazard.
Discolored Walls or Ceilings
Water damage can cause discoloration or staining on walls and ceilings. This can be a sign of a leak or water infiltration.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
Unusual noises or sounds, such as creaks or groans, can indicate structural damage or settling.
Water Stains or Leaks
Visible water stains or leaks can indicate a problem with your roof, gutters, or plumbing.
Unpleasant Smells or Fumes
Unpleasant smells or fumes can indicate mold growth or other health risks.

Storm Damage Restoration Cost in Woodland Hills, UT
The cost of storm damage restoration var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on typical scenarios, and actual costs may vary.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Mold rem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old |
| Structural drying and rep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of damage |
| Final inspection and c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ning needed |
| Equipment rental and labor |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
